Abstract

Provided is a planar lightwave circuit module in which the required optical components constituting an optical fiber amplifier and representing components other than amplifying optical fibers are formed into a unitary structure on a common substrate. This planar lightwave circuit module comprises signal light input ports, signal light output ports, and first and second connection ports. The first connection port is connected to the signal light output ports and to one end of an amplifying optical fiber. The second connection port is connected to the signal light input ports and to the other end of the amplifying optical fiber. Optical coupling means for feeding pumping light from an pumping source to the amplifying optical fiber are also provided in the form of waveguides or in integrated form. Amplifying optical fibers are connected from the outside to the first and second connection ports of this planar lightwave circuit module, yielding an optical fiber amplifier.
